In Episode 23 of The Sailing Podcast, host Theo Stocker sits down inside the tiny, 19-foot cabin of Mini Globe 580,Trekker with one of the friendliest and most intrepid sailors on the planet: Ertan Beskardes.
Ertan’s story is extraordinary. Born in Turkey, he learned to sail on the Bosphorus as a 12-year-old boy, tying his tiny fiberglass dinghy to navigation cardinals in the dark to sleep under the stars.
After moving to the UK, he built a 40-year career as a military tailor and regalia specialist before answering the call of the high seas.
Ertan competed in the 2018 and 2022 Golden Globe Races (GGR), but the raw emotional toll of being separated from his family forced him to step aside. More recently, he completed an unbelievable tropical circumnavigation in the 19ft Mini Globe Race (MGR), complete with Starlink, Netflix, and daily FaceTime calls. Now, he’s set his sights back on the ultimate prize: sailing solo, non-stop around the globe in the 2026 GGR aboard Jean-Luc Van Den Heede’s 2018 winning Rustler 36, Matmut (now renamed Miss Beagle).
